Titel Tropospheric Ozone Columns During Biomass Burning Events as Seen from SCIAMACHY Using Limb-Nadir-Matching
VerfasserIn Stefan Bötel, Annette Ladstätter-Weißenmayer, Felix Ebojie, Christian von Savigny, John P. Burrows

Zusammenfassung
SCIAMACHY (Scanning Imaging Absorption Spectrometer for Atmospheric ChartographY) launched in March 2002 measures sunlight, transmitted, reflected and scattered by the earth atmosphere or surface (240 nm - 2380 nm). SCIAMACHY measurements yield the amounts and distribution of O3, BrO, OClO, ClO, SO2, H2CO, NO2, CO, CO2, CH4, H2O, N2O, p, T, aerosol, radiation, cloud cover and cloud top height in limb as well as nadir mode. With it’s collocated limb and nadir measurements limb-nadir-matching can be used to determine tropospheric ozone columns from SCIAMACHY limb and nadir measurements. Using this method a number of case studies of recent biomass burning events will be shown.
